In an unprecedented turn of events that has left the film industry reeling, a brief video clip showcasing a fictional fight between Hollywood heavyweights Tom Cruise and Brad Pitt was unveiled. This 15-second masterpiece is the brainchild of ByteDance’s artificial intelligence (AI) tool, marking a significant milestone in the realm of cinema history. The video clip, which has been making waves across social media platforms, showcases an extraordinary level of cinematic quality that surpasses anything previously produced by human directors and filmmakers. The AI-generated footage is so lifelike and polished that it’s challenging to distinguish it from a professionally shot scene featuring the two A-list actors in their prime. To put this development into historical context, we must first understand the evolution of computer-generated imagery (CGI) within the film industry. CGI has been an integral part of cinema since the 1970s, with groundbreaking films like “Star Wars” and “Jurassic Park” showcasing its potential to create fantastical worlds and creatures that would otherwise be impossible on screen. However, these early examples of CGI were still noticeably artificial, lacking the subtle nuances and emotional depth required for truly convincing performances.
